Riverside Golf Course is a public course located near the scenic Rock River on the northwest side of Janesville, Wisconsin. Designed by architect Robert Bruce Harris, the course has earned recognition as one of Wisconsin's best public golf courses, receiving accolades including a 2023 Golfpass ranking among the Top 25 Public Courses in Wisconsin and a 2021 National Golf Foundation Customer Satisfaction award for Standard/Value Courses.

The course is notably the host venue for the Ray Fischer Tournament, one of the most prestigious amateur events in the Midwest. This tournament has launched the careers of numerous PGA Tour professionals, including former winners Steve Stricker and Skip Kendall. The course's setting along the Rock River provides an attractive natural landscape for play. With its combination of quality design, scenic location, and hosting of significant tournaments, Riverside has established itself as a prominent destination for public golf in the region.
